What Are Cam Phasers and How Do They Function?
Cam phasers are sophisticated hydraulic mechanisms within an engine’s valvetrain that adjust camshaft timing dynamically. They work by:
- Controlling intake and exhaust valve opening and closing periods
- Optimizing engine performance and fuel efficiency
- Allowing variable valve timing for different driving conditions

What Symptoms Indicate Potential Cam Phaser Failure?
Recognizing early warning signs can prevent extensive engine damage:
- Unusual Engine Noises
- Rattling sounds during idle
- Clicking noises from the valvetrain
-
Persistent ticking at different engine temperatures
-
Performance Degradation
- Reduced acceleration
- Inconsistent engine power
-
Rough idling conditions
-
Check Engine Warning
- Illuminated check engine light
- Diagnostic trouble codes related to camshaft positioning

Preventative Maintenance Strategies
To mitigate cam phaser damage:
- Regular oil changes
- Use manufacturer-recommended oil
- Address warning signs immediately
- Schedule periodic professional inspections
